mahara mahara 22.04.0 vulnerabilities and exploits
(subscribe to this query)
8.8
CVSSv3
CVE-2022-28892
Mahara prior to 20.10.5, 21.04.4, 21.10.2, and 22.04.0 is vulnerable to Cross Site Request Forgery (CSRF) because randomly generated tokens are too easily guessable.
Mahara Mahara 22.04.0
Mahara Mahara
5.4
CVSSv3
CVE-2022-29584
Mahara prior to 20.10.5, 21.04.4, 21.10.2, and 22.04.0 allows stored XSS when a particular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) class for embedly is used, and JavaScript code is constructed to perform an action.
Mahara Mahara 22.04.0
Mahara Mahara
7.5
CVSSv3
CVE-2022-29585
In Mahara prior to 20.10.5, 21.04.4, 21.10.2, and 22.04.0, a site using Isolated Institutions is vulnerable if more than ten groups are used. They are all shown from page 2 of the group results list (rather than only being shown for the institution that the viewer is a member of)...
